A-Pillar Trim Panel Replacement: DIY Installation Guide
Replacing an A-pillar trim panel is a beginner-to-intermediate DIY task that typically takes 30–60 minutes per panel, depending on how the panel is fastened. If you're comfortable using basic hand tools and removing interior trim pieces, this is an achievable project at home. However, the exact steps, fastener types, and specifications vary significantly by vehicle make and model—always consult your service manual for torque specs, fastening sequences, and any electrical disconnection requirements specific to your vehicle.

Before You Begin
- Park your vehicle on a level surface, set the parking brake, and turn off the engine before starting work.
- Disconnect the negative battery terminal if the A-pillar panel contains any electrical sensors, lighting elements, or wiring connections.
- Inspect the old panel from both inside and outside the vehicle to identify whether it is held by bolts, screws, clips, or adhesive—this will inform your removal strategy.
- Ensure adequate lighting in the work area; A-pillars are tight spaces, and poor visibility can lead to damaged fasteners or stripped threads.
Step-by-Step: How to Replace Your A-Pillar Trim Panel
- Prepare your workspace and protect surrounding surfaces. Set up a clean, well-lit work area near your vehicle. Use masking tape to protect the window frame, door frame, and any painted surfaces adjacent to the A-pillar to prevent accidental scratches during removal and reinstallation.
- Disconnect the negative battery terminal. Loosen the bolt on the negative terminal clamp and slide it off the battery post. This step is essential if your A-pillar panel contains any electrical components, sensors, or wiring. Even if the panel appears to be purely cosmetic, disconnecting the battery prevents accidental electrical shorts during work.
- Remove fasteners holding the old panel in place. Locate all bolts, screws, or clips securing the A-pillar trim. Remove them carefully using the appropriate tool—a socket for bolts, a screwdriver for screws, or a plastic pry tool for clips. Keep all fasteners in a small container so you don't lose them; you may reuse them if they're in good condition. Remember that specific fastener locations, torque specifications, and removal sequences vary by vehicle—consult your service manual for the exact procedure and any special tools required.
- Gently detach the old panel from the A-pillar structure. Once fasteners are removed, carefully peel or pry the panel away from the mounting surface. If adhesive is present, use a plastic pry tool or panel removal tool to avoid gouging the pillar structure or damaging the door frame. Work slowly around the perimeter of the panel to distribute pressure evenly.
- Clean the mounting surface and inspect the pillar. With the old panel removed, wipe away any dust, debris, or adhesive residue from the A-pillar structure using a clean cloth. Examine the mounting points, bolt holes, and the pillar surface itself for damage, corrosion, or misalignment that could affect the new panel's fit or appearance. If you notice bent fastener holes or structural damage, professional assessment is recommended before installing a new panel.
- Test-fit the new panel without fully securing fasteners. Position the new A-pillar trim panel into place and loosely install one or two fasteners to hold it temporarily. This allows you to verify proper alignment with the window frame, door frame, and adjacent panels before committing to full installation. Look for even gaps and ensure the panel sits flush against the pillar structure.
- Fully secure all fasteners. Once alignment is confirmed, install and tighten all remaining fasteners. Use the correct tool for each fastener type, and tighten to snug—avoid over-tightening bolts into plastic panels, as excessive torque can crack or strip mounting points. If your service manual specifies torque values for A-pillar fasteners, use a torque wrench to ensure proper tightness without damaging the panel.
- Reconnect the battery terminal and perform a final inspection. Slide the negative battery terminal back onto the battery post and tighten the clamp bolt. Inspect the newly installed panel from both inside and outside the vehicle, checking for even panel gaps, proper sealing against adjacent trim, and correct door operation. If the panel contains any electrical components, verify that lights, sensors, or connections function properly.
Tips for a Successful A-Pillar Trim Panel Replacement
- Avoid over-tightening fasteners into plastic trim panels—hand-tight plus a quarter turn is usually sufficient. Excessive torque can crack the panel or strip plastic mounting bosses.
- If the old panel is bonded with adhesive rather than mechanical fasteners, use a heat gun (on low setting) to warm the adhesive slightly, making it easier to peel the panel away without damaging the pillar structure.
- Photograph the old panel installation before removal, especially if fastener locations are unclear or if the panel has multiple connection points. This reference image can guide reinstallation and prevent mistakes.
- Use only plastic pry tools or panel removal tools on A-pillar trim; metal tools can mar the paint on the pillar or damage adjacent plastic trim if they slip.
When to Call a Professional
If the old A-pillar panel is permanently bonded with strong structural adhesive, professional removal may be safer and less time-consuming than attempting to peel it away manually. Additionally, if your A-pillar panel includes integrated sensors, lighting, or electrical connectors that are unclear or non-standard, a mechanic can ensure proper disconnection and reconnection to prevent electrical faults. If the mounting points on the pillar are bent, cracked, or corroded, or if the pillar structure itself appears damaged, stop work and have a professional inspect the area before installing a new panel. While A-pillar trim is cosmetic and non-safety-critical, poor installation can affect door sealing and interior aesthetics. If you're uncertain about any step or encounter unexpected fastening methods, consulting a professional is the safest choice.
